Nobody knows. There are still plenty of trailers parked in front of houses being renovated by their stubborn former residents. Most parts of the uninhabitable areas (the 9th ward and so on) are still empty, and the $64K question is whether to rebuild residential, let nature reclaim it as swampland, or rebuild it as a giant park or something.

Many people are resettled and don't want to come back. The hypothetical miraculous recovery is unanswerable because it will never happen.
